The CT examinations were performed on a 16-section CT device made by Siemens (Sensation 16, dedicated … WebNov 14, 2024 · They each consist of an anterior vertebral body, and a posterior vertebral arch. Vertebral Body The vertebral body forms the anterior part of each vertebrae. It is the weight-bearing component, and vertebrae in the lower portion of the column have larger bodies than those in the upper portion (to better support the increased weight).

The different types of bone cells include the following: 1. Osteoblast. Found within the bone, its function is to form new bone tissue. 2. Osteoclast. A very large cell formed in bone marrow, its function is to absorb and remove unwanted tissue. 3. Osteocyte. Found within the bone, its function is to help maintain … See more Bone is living tissue that makes up the body's skeleton. There are 3 types of bone tissue, including the following: 1. Compact tissue. The harder, outer tissue of bones. 2. Cancellous tissue. … See more Bone provides shape and support for the body, as well as protection for some organs.
